Job description

Job Description


Bring your technical talent to the Pilot team! This opportunity is not too good to be true; you’ll receive an annual company performance-based bonus, enjoy weekends off, and have no on-call requirements. You’ll be dispatched from home, work 45–50+ hours per week, and port to port.


We provide a company service vehicle, tools, equipment, cell phone, and iPad (personal tools are also allowed). You will play an important part in keeping approximately 15 store locations running smoothly throughout the Cheyenne, WY region.


Position Summary

The purpose of this role is to perform installations, preventive maintenance, and repairs on facility HVAC/R systems, food service equipment, plumbing, fuel dispensers, and electrical systems within various food and retail locations.


Responsibilities


  • Respond to service requests; troubleshoot, diagnose, and repair equipment in accordance with warranty requirements and industry standards

  • Communicate repair status with the service technician supervisor and store management

  • Complete same-day work order notes and submit them to your supervisor; ensure proper charge allocations

  • Monitor and maintain adequate stock levels

  • Maintain service vehicle, tools, and uniforms to company standards

  • Diagnose and repair fuel dispensers, replace fuel filters, and work on fuel security systems (training provided)

  • Inspect facility interiors and exteriors for safety and maintenance issues

  • Perform preventive maintenance on equipment, including but not limited to: rooftop HVAC units, split systems, ice machines, standalone refrigeration, fryers, and other food service equipment

  • Ensure all repairs and work activities comply with OSHA and Pilot Company regulations

  • Model company values and support exceptional guest and team member experiences

  • Follow all rules, policies, procedures, and safety standards established by Pilot Company
